Transaction 3ff4846576e229c65eb31338c68f142e066026fbced6f12394faa70416fa2667
1 Input
2 Outputs
- 3ff4846576e229c65eb31338c68f142e066026fbced6f12394faa70416fa2667:0
- 3ff4846576e229c65eb31338c68f142e066026fbced6f12394faa70416fa2667:1
value 31620
address 1FSTA6DHib92dXPXRNFpgnq7p5NiwAUg6K
value 1081929
address 3DMn5Qt2sqbANbCaTtkw6XXd2LcxhGNVBC